Willie Mullins grabs Grade One double as eight-year-old Impaire Et Impasse wins the feature on the opening day at Aintree and Il Etait Temps earlier victory
Impaire Et Passe had to survive a stewards' inquiry before claiming a narrow victory in a superb three-way finish to the William Hill Aintree Hurdle on day one of the 2024 Randox Grand National Festival at Aintree Racecourse .
Having bypassed last month’s Cheltenham Festival, Willie Mullins' eight-year-old grabbed a nose victory in the Grade One feature of the opening day at the famous Liverpool track to show.. In a superb end to the 2m4f contest there was little to separate the three challengers at the line.
